Paradise Point Cottages offers a tranquil escape nestled in the serene surroundings of Errol, NH. Guests can unwind in cozy accommodations designed for a peaceful retreat.
The property provides a relaxing atmosphere for visitors seeking a quiet getaway in nature, with a focus on simplicity and comfort.
Generated from their business information